The Chinese population believes in healthy eating and maintaining good health. Qigong is a type of exercise which is extremely popular in the country. This helps in staying fit and cultivating the spiritual side of man. Martial arts are also popular here that helps in creating strong body and mind. Learning and practicing this art is a part of their lifestyle. People in China eat with the help of chopsticks and they do not prefer very spicy food. In addition to these, the Chinese population is heavily into painting and calligraphy. They are also expert in playing chess and also play a musical instrument known as Qin.

The people in China basically lead a simple lifestyle. Their lifestyle is based on Confucius philosophy propagating hard work, belief in family and practice self-control. Religion is of utmost importance. Festivals are an integral part of their life as well culture. Both modern and traditional festivals are celebrated with gusto. The Spring Festival is one of the most important festivals in the country. Other important ones include Ghost festival, lantern festival, Dragon Boat festival.
